First Avatar picture available!

Avatar pinball, you as player are the hero Jake Sully. Capture the pinball in the transporter link, a case that reveals a Jake figurine, and transform yourself into his Avatar.
Then, after a series of challenges, get past the motorized up/down target bank protecting Colonel Quaritch and fight the Colonel in his AMP Suit, aiming your pinball at him. As you overtake the Colonel, his AMP Suit crashes to the ground and you save the Na'vi people from total destruction.

Avatar pinball also features a twisting ramp, the magnet for random ballplay,and lots of multi-ball action.Avatar pinball has lots of great sound, including speech and soundeffects from the movie as well as original voice over by actor Stephen Lang, who plays Colonel Quaritch in the movie.

 

More news is that the backglass will be in 3D, remember games like Star Wars Trilogy by Sega. This game had an optional 3D backglass.

The following part is taken from Pinballsales.com:

Iron Man Pinball features speech, art, and dot matrix display images of all of the popular characters, including Tony Stark, Iron Man, Whiplash, War Machine, Rhodey, Iron Monger,

Pepper Potts, Black Widow, and many more. 

The pinball machine also contains songs from the Iron Man movie score.

Pinball players will fight against Whiplash and his ball-catching mechanism,

which whips the ball around the playfield.

More BBH pics from the test location + short vid!

And now there are also pictures available from the BBH on his test location with great thanks to RGP member Andrew Barney!

Here's the adaptation to our previous playfieldreview so if you combine this one and the previous you get a pretty good idea what the game probably is about.

The three green standuptargets at the left are Peppy's Pince and serve as a Mystery.

Left orbit shot serves to start Elk and probably some jackpots by Big Buck Multiball.

The ramp is the Moose and here you can collect Extra Ball and Special, the ramps will be used to collect moose for the wizard mode and this can be as easy as X ramp hits or starting a mode.

Next to that we have something I would like to call the "Battering Ram", this shot will be important to collect 'Ram' and starts double scoring. This shot can be compared to the raptor shot on Jurassic Park and the Ripper shot on Last Action Hero.

The red standuptarget at the right you have to use to shoot different birds out of the sky like turkeys and ducks, the ball can be trapped here and this will probably used to start 'Bird multiball'. Bird is another requirement for the Wizard Mode.
